Special memorial remarks from Captain John Schneidwind of the Schaumburg Fire Department, first responder on September 11, 2001. Memorial ceremony for the victims of the Sept. 11, 2001, terrorist attacks. Schaumburg Fire Department Captain and 9/11 first responder John Schneidwind was the speaker of honor. He shared his firsthand experience assisting at Ground Zero in the aftermath of the tragedy.
ESTATE PLANNING FOR YOU AND YOUR BUSINESS!
It’s been said that “failing to plan is planning to fail.” Nowhere is this old adage more applicable than in preparing yourself and your business for your death or incapacity. Although these can be difficult topics to consider, it is vitally important – especially as a business owner – to develop a comprehensive plan, to implement that plan, and to ensure that others are aware of your plan and understand your wishes.
In this installment of Good Morning Schaumburg, attorney Heather Walser will discuss the pitfalls of failing to plan for your death or incapacity. We will explore what this planning means for both you personally and for your business, and identify the best approaches for dealing with common issues and concerns related to business succession, personal planning, and potential tax impacts.
